Class: BuildingSync::FloorAreas::FloorArea
- Inherits:
-
Object
- Object
- BuildingSync::FloorAreas::FloorArea
- Defined in:
- lib/BuildingSync.rb
Overview
http://buildingsync.net/schemas/bedes-auc/2019FloorArea
floorAreaType - SOAP::SOAPString
floorAreaCustomName - SOAP::SOAPString
floorAreaValue - BuildingSync::FloorAreas::FloorArea::FloorAreaValue
floorAreaPercentage - SOAP::SOAPFloat
story - SOAP::SOAPInt
excludedSectionIDs - BuildingSync::FloorAreas::FloorArea::ExcludedSectionIDs
Defined Under Namespace
Classes: ExcludedSectionIDs, FloorAreaValue
Instance Attribute Summary collapse
-
#excludedSectionIDs ⇒ Object
Returns the value of attribute excludedSectionIDs.
-
#floorAreaCustomName ⇒ Object
Returns the value of attribute floorAreaCustomName.
-
#floorAreaPercentage ⇒ Object
Returns the value of attribute floorAreaPercentage.
-
#floorAreaType ⇒ Object
Returns the value of attribute floorAreaType.
-
#floorAreaValue ⇒ Object
Returns the value of attribute floorAreaValue.
-
#story ⇒ Object
Returns the value of attribute story.
Instance Method Summary collapse
-
#initialize(floorAreaType = nil, floorAreaCustomName = nil, floorAreaValue = nil, floorAreaPercentage = nil, story = nil, excludedSectionIDs = nil) ⇒ FloorArea
constructor
A new instance of FloorArea.
Constructor Details
#initialize(floorAreaType = nil, floorAreaCustomName = nil, floorAreaValue = nil, floorAreaPercentage = nil, story = nil, excludedSectionIDs = nil) ⇒ FloorArea
Returns a new instance of FloorArea.
21122 21123 21124 21125 21126 21127 21128 21129 |
# File 'lib/BuildingSync.rb', line 21122 def initialize(floorAreaType = nil, floorAreaCustomName = nil, floorAreaValue = nil, floorAreaPercentage = nil, story = nil, excludedSectionIDs = nil) @floorAreaType = floorAreaType @floorAreaCustomName = floorAreaCustomName @floorAreaValue = floorAreaValue @floorAreaPercentage = floorAreaPercentage @story = story @excludedSectionIDs = excludedSectionIDs end |
Instance Attribute Details
#excludedSectionIDs ⇒ Object
Returns the value of attribute excludedSectionIDs.
21120 21121 21122 |
# File 'lib/BuildingSync.rb', line 21120 def excludedSectionIDs @excludedSectionIDs end |
#floorAreaCustomName ⇒ Object
Returns the value of attribute floorAreaCustomName.
21116 21117 21118 |
# File 'lib/BuildingSync.rb', line 21116 def floorAreaCustomName @floorAreaCustomName end |
#floorAreaPercentage ⇒ Object
Returns the value of attribute floorAreaPercentage.
21118 21119 21120 |
# File 'lib/BuildingSync.rb', line 21118 def floorAreaPercentage @floorAreaPercentage end |
#floorAreaType ⇒ Object
Returns the value of attribute floorAreaType.
21115 21116 21117 |
# File 'lib/BuildingSync.rb', line 21115 def floorAreaType @floorAreaType end |
#floorAreaValue ⇒ Object
Returns the value of attribute floorAreaValue.
21117 21118 21119 |
# File 'lib/BuildingSync.rb', line 21117 def floorAreaValue @floorAreaValue end |
#story ⇒ Object
Returns the value of attribute story.
21119 21120 21121 |
# File 'lib/BuildingSync.rb', line 21119 def story @story end |